I need to IO utilization for Process by Process ID without using any tool like iostat,iotop etc. Displaying I/O Statistics - The iostat commandIf I know the PID number of a process, how can I get its name? How to get I/O usage by process in Unix? get disk io per process without SU at linux. How to get process id of specific process name in linux?Please see below my partial program. processid (pidof testQA) if processid > 0 then echo nothing else echo Server down | mail. How do I search for a process by name without using grep? sort you get a sorted list of processes names, Unix Linux Ask Differentfind process name by pid. linux get process id. ps -ef | grep (process name). The line will look as follows : (userid) ( process id) (process id2) (time) (terminal) . kill -9 (process name or process id).How can I get the process id or process name? Again, thanks a lot! Jose Diaz. param name Name of the process./ static void getprocessparentid(const pidt pid, pidt ppid). char buffer[BUFSIZ] I want to get the process name from the process id (pid) in C/C program. Please help me. I am using linux machine.return ProcessStruct.th32ProcessID break Please see below my partial program. processid (pidof testQA) if processid > 0 then echo "nothing" else echo "Server down" | mail "testdomain.com". In Linux and Unix-like systems, each process is assigned a process ID, or PID. So, we need to check I/O activity on hard drive.If I know the PID number of a process, how can I get its name? The example in this topic demonstrates how to create a child process using the CreateProcess function You can use: Ps -ef | grep [j]ava. Or if pgrep is available then better to use: Pgrep -f java. A Note About Process IDs.
In Linux and Unix-like systems, each process is assigned a process ID, or PID.How To Send Processes Signals by Name. Although the conventional way of sending signals is through the use of PIDs, there are also methods of doing this with regular process names. The Linux /proc filesystem can be used to get the arguments passed to a process.
First, we need to get the process id or PID (process id) of the process that we are interested in.Notice that pgrep also prints out the process id and process name together with the command line arguments. This selects the processes whose executable name is. given in cmdlist. - f Do full-format listing.A cool trick. ps -ejH. You will get all the processes with names.Unix Linux. continue / If comm matches our process name, extract the process ID from the.1Finding a running process (pid) by name in Linux. The kernel identifies each process using a process ID (PID), a every instance of process mustFind Linux Process Name. For additional usage information and options, look through the ps man page.Join Our Community Of 150,000 Linux Lovers and get a weekly newsletter in your inbox. So how do I get only the process id for a specific process name. Sample programNeed help to find certificate by Subject name (X500 format, CERTX500 NAMESTR) using CertFindCertificateInStore()? I need to IO utilization for Process by Process ID without using any tool like iostat,iotop etc.If I know the PID number of a process, how can I get its name? up vote 176 down vote favorite. A walkthrough on how to find processes that are causing high I/O Wait on Linux Systems Written by Benjamin Hi there, I need a command to get the process name by process id. any help will be appreciated. Shekhar. I tried ps and filter by name, but I can not distinguish process by names .You can get the process id from pid.Get real time CPU usage of linux process with single line command and as a simple result. 0. Linux command line: When i execute the following command. ps -ef |grep tomcat.can some body help me how can i get tomcat process id by its name regex for "-rum". In Linux and Unix-like systems, each process is assigned a process ID, or PID. top process causing I/O. Alternatively you Monitor system resources using HTop, SAR commands.If I know the PID number of a process, how can I get its name? linux unix io load cpu-usage. Where is from the last output. But how to do this in one line? If your ps command knowsThis entry was posted in Linux. Bookmark the permalink. Pgrep only search for the process name without the full path (in your case only java) and without arguments. Since tomcat-5.5-26-rum is part of the latter, id search the pid with. I want to write a shell script ( .sh file) to get a given process id. What Im trying to do here is once I get the process ID, I want to kill that process. Im running on Ubuntu ( Linux). I killed a process by process ID accidentally, but now I need to know the process name.I checked the id number under folder /proc,but I got anything. how can I know the process name please.There is no standard mechanism in Linux to discover the name of a deleted process. You can find the process name or the command used by the process-id or pid from.Not the answer youre looking for? Browse other questions tagged linux unix shell process pid or ask your own question. linux - access a processs kernel stack given process id in kernel debugging. Execute a program in kernel space in Linux. linux kernel - how to get name of USB module in android. I need to IO utilization for Process by Process ID without using any tool like iostat,iotop etc. How could I get the percentage of I/O usage by process?In Linux and Unix-like systems, each process is assigned a process ID, or PID. pgrep only search for the process name without the full path (in How to get only the process ID for a specified process name in linux?So how do I get only the process id for a specific process name. Sample program: PIDS ps -ef|grep java if [ -z "PIDS" ] then echo "nothing" else mail [email protected] fi. PID is the process id, PPID is the parent (which you really do NOT want to kill).Related. Red Hat OpenStack Platform 12 Pushes Containers Forward. Difference Between Major Number And Minor Number In Linux ? The process identifier (process ID or PID) is a number used by Linux or Unix operating system kernels. It is used to uniquely identify an active process. Procedure to find process by name on Linux. Hi, is that possible to get the process id, using a process name in c program.few question arises with this link if you want to create a single instance application in linux using daemon process, then problem arises. Re: get process ID in C. What are you going to do with this program? First of all, in Linux there is no such thing as the "foreground" process in the general case as it is a multi-user, multi- process OS, what process is in the foreground really depends on what foreground youre talking about. General :: Killing Parent Process Without Killing Child Process (Linux C Programming)? Programming :: Displaying Process Id In Shell Script But There Is No Such Process?General :: Pinning Process To A CPU? General :: Where Does Netstat Get The Process Name. Please see below my partial program. processid (pidof testQA) if processid > 0 then echo "nothing" else echo "Server down" | mail "[email protected]" crontab: 30 test.sh How to get process id from process name in linux ?Linux command get tomcat process id by name. This program will get the Process Id and Parent Process Id of the current Process in C programming Linux. Although it seems like a pretty common activity, locating a running process by name is a little harder in Linux than youd expect. Various solutions are available on the web, ranging from code relying on sysctl calls to samples that use the results from running certain bash scripts. I am new to C Linux programming and for exercise I am trying to get executable name from process id. If I provide the process id myself then it works fine, but if process id is being provided dynamically in a while loop then the readlink returns -1. Could anyone help me, any help is appreciated. The requirement is to the get the process id from process name. Since ACE does not support this, we will have to use platform specific macros to separate the code for windows and linux. For windows I would have to use either of If you already have the PID of a process, running the following command will get you the process name ls -l /proc/PID/exe.Next story How to check if there is a process listening on a port in linux. In this post I will talk about a procedure to find the process IDs of a running process by name, which can then be used to send signals orFor example if you want to get the command name of a process using the PID 27527 then do.Pingback: Generate the process tree of a Linux system | Phoxis. For that I need the process id of the process. I tried to get it using:ret system(.Get process id by name in C. C function to find a process ID and kill it. 6181. | OReilly linux System Administration. Andress - Surviving Security - How to Integrate People, Process and Technology 2e (Auerbach, 2004).chm. In Linux and Unix-like systems, each process is assigned a process ID, or PID. Mapping disk I/O by process is Storage. pgrep only search for the process name withoutSecurity. at the lack of good storage management and monitoring tools for Linux. get disk io per process without SU at linux. NAME top. getpid, getppid - get process identification.DESCRIPTION top. getpid() returns the process ID (PID) of the calling process. (This. is often used by routines that generate unique temporary filenames.) Pidof finds the process ids (pids) of the named programs. It prints those ids on the standard output.linux get current process id. pidof source code. This kills a process by its name instead of its pid . Tested on RH9 Linux save as filename killer and chmod ax it to kill kwrite, for instanceget process name from process id I need to know the name of the parent process. using getppid function I can get the process id of the parent process. Boost BGP Network Performance by 42 - [Free Demo].
How to get the process ID (PID)In some cases, you may want to know the process ID (PID) of the subshell where your shell script is running.For example, you can create a unique temporary file in /tmp by naming it with the shell script PID.Displaying Input/Output Statistics, cpu statistics, displaying virtual memory statistics If I know the PID number of a process, how can I get its name?Here I will introduce several disk I/O monitoring tools on Linux. iotop: Per Process I/O Usage. I need to IO utilization for Process by Process ID 4.1.4. Displaying process information. The ps command is one of the tools for visualizing processes.This example shows all processes with a process name of bash, the most common login shell on Linux systems getppid() returns the process ID of the parent of the calling process.getppid(2) - Linux man page. Name. getpid, getppid - get process identification.